Monsieur Benjamin brings a priest of France to San Francisco. The place is in the Hayes Valley neighborhood and is brimming with Parisian bistro culture. The menu is also inspired by the traditions of French cuisine – bistro classics such as onion soup and steak tartare are among the house favourites. But also the quail or chicken liver pâté with apple compote and toasted brioche is heavenly. You can tell that chef and starred chef Corey Lee has mastered his craft. The service is excellent and the wine list is well stocked. However, everything has its price. It is not a place for a quick dinner, but rather one where you go for a special occasion.
